Certification Options
Exceed Safety Certification =
certification issued by us to demonstrate that training has been completed to meet national best practice guidance and occupational standards.
External Awarding Body Certification =
Nationally recognised awarding body certification to meet National Occupational Standards.
Administered by NHSS (National Highways Sector Scheme)
Accredited by Ofqual Registered awarding body (Government office of qualifications and examinations regulation) -
This certification is specifically referred to and recommended by compliance requirements and guidance as provided by,
HSE (Health & Safety Executive) guidance,
BSI (British Standards Institute) publications such as 'PAS43'
and many other work provider/contract and site requirements.
Certification code VR03

1 Day Course
Scene Safety & Risk Management in Mobile Assistance Situations
Dynamic Risk Assessment
Hazards & Risk Factors
Best Practice guidance
Assistance Vehicle position/parking
Correct use of lighting and PPE
Coning and signage requirements
Road Traffic Law factors
Procedures for different road types
Procedures for premises/sites
Duty of care
Public / Pedestrians / Road users
Manual Handling - COSHH - Working at height - Slips/Trips - PPE - (Brief overview as applicable the scene/work being completed)
Courses focus on Scene Safety & Risk Management
Attending to vehicles, Machinery or Equipment in Varied and Changeable locations.
Different types of work being completed and working areas encountered are discussed and included in the training/risk assessment as relevant to each trainee and can include:
Attending to:
HGV's, Buses, Coaches
Vans, Cars & Motorbikes
Construction & Plant Machinery
Boom Lifts, Scissor Lifts & MEWPS
Mobile Generators / Power Units etc
Working Areas may include :
At the roadside, All road types
Lay by's, Services, Car Parks
Public & pedestrianised areas
Business / Company premises
Construction, other working sites
Appropriate & Recommended for :
Mobile Service, Maintenance & Repair Technicians
Mobile Mechanics
Recovery Technicians
Fleet Assistance Technicians
Breakdown Technicians
